Got this a while back and I like it so much I just had to review it. The price is great as are all of the Mama Bear soaps, I only wish I had bought a few other scents and saved on shipping. There will be more MB soaps on the way soon!
The scent of this soap is great and there's plenty of it too:w00t:. I enjoy the scent so much that I usually don't use a scented aftershave in my post shave routine with this, just a splash of witch hazel and a bit of unscented face lotion.
The lather from this soap whips right up easily with any of my badger brushes after letting about a teaspoon of water sit on the surface for a few minutes and loading up a soaked and then well shaken brush. I get tons of thick, rich, slick, meringue textured lather with very little effort. There is always plenty of lather left in the bowl and the brush even after a four pass shave with some extra touch-ups for difficult areas of the neck. Did I mention slick? This lather is slippery as greased glass, the blade just glides right over my skin and the richness of the thick lather provides great cushion. I've only gotten a couple drops of blood in four or five shaves with this soap and those were due more to my being over zealous with the touch ups on my neck than a lack of quality in the lather.
The only rating I gave less than a 10 is for moisturizing, the soap doesn't dry my face out like some others have, but it doesn't really seem to moisturize either. I can live with that as I usually only need to moisturize in the winter since my skin is a bit on the oily side.
Overall, this is a great product and I can't wait to get more Mama Bear soaps to try!:thumbup1::thumbup1:

Let me start by saying that by-and-large, I'm a shaving cream guy. That said, Mama Bear's Dragon's blood blew me away. Fantastic incense-like scent which lingers a bit post-shave (a good thing), so you may want to skip the cologne or wear something that matches. BBS shave except for my neck (not unusual for me). My only real "negative" is that it didn't later quite as much as I'm used to from a cream, but this is probably a fault with my technique and not the soap. All-in-all, a great, comforatable shave (3 passes, no irritation). HIghly recommended as a fall/winter scent and it will definitely take a place among all my shaving creams.
